Nel Farms launches new corporate brand identity

Thursday, 29 May 2014 00:00 -     - {{hitsCtrl.values.hits}}

The new Nel Farms (Noorani Estates Ltd.) logo and corporate brand identify were unveiled on Tuesday by Noorani Estates Director Noordeen Sethwala at the Ramada Hotel, in the presence of the company’s Board of Directors, senior management, and distinguished guests. The guest speaker in attendance was Dr. Renuka Jayatissa, Nutrition Specialist of UNICEF and the former Head of Nutrition of the Medical Research Institute of Sri Lanka. At the launch, Nel Farms was also awarded SLS certification for both its egg farms (7 Hills Farm and Mangala Eliya Farm). The award was presented by Sri Lanka Standards Institute (SLSI) Assistant Director (Technical) Janaki Chandrasekara. Nel Farms has delivered high quality poultry products for seven decades and was the pioneer in catering to the country’s growing demand for clean, safe and high quality table eggs Nel Farms is revamping its brand to align with current trends and also effectively communicate the quality and reliability that the brand represents Nel Farms is an ISO 22000, HACCP and GMP certified organisation and delivers a promise of trusted excellence. Nel farms was incorporated in 1942 and initially focused on tea, rubber and coconut production. In 1974, the company moved its focus to poultry production and has thereafter experienced steady grow Nel Farms has been in operation for over 70 years and is built on the principles of its forefathers – who were committed to delivering the best quality produce at an affordable price. Today Nel Farms is one of the largest poultry farming operations in Sri Lanka. The company comprises of breeder farms and hatcheries for both broiler and layer day-old chicks as well as commercial layer farms comprising state-of-the-art egg farming facilities. Nel Farms is a leading producer of commercial layers and continuously invests in modern, industry leading facilities to maximise the level of disease protection and optimise the poultry house environment for the wellbeing of all flocks. The Nel Farms egg farming operation in Hatton is built on systematic processes and quality measures Nel Farms is a fully-integrated layer operation that ensures complete control of each process of the operation. Nel Farms’ hens are fed a well-balanced diet which is rich in proteins, vitamins and minerals, additionally a clean and calm environment is created for the hens. The proprietary feed formulation is responsible for the trademark golden yolk eggs produced by Nel Farms. The entire egg farming operation at Nel Farms is extremely sterilised which ensures that all Nel Farms eggs are safe and wholesome. None of the Nel Farms eggs are fertilised and therefore none of the eggs contain life. The Nel Farms egg farming operation comprises a series of organized processes and stages. Day-old chicks arrive at the farm from their own hatcheries and after 18 weeks they are transferred to the layer section. In the layer section, hens are provided with a nourishing feed and the ideal conditions for laying are created.  Each hen lays an egg approximately every 20 hours and eggs are collected four times a day. The best eggs are then selected and transferred to the egg room where they are cleaned and mechanically graded. Following a final inspection, the eggs are then packaged for the local and export markets accordingly. Eggs are sent to the distributor on the same day or early on the following day. All eggs usually reach the marketplace within one day, delivering optimal freshness and quality to Nel Farms’ customers.
